Nissan Magnite 2026 price hike details

The Magnite crossover SUV is the only Nissan car on sale in India. The brand has now announced that it will hike its prices from January 1, 2026, citing the rising input and raw material costs and the forex rates.

The expected price hike is up to 3%, which means that the top variants of Magnite could witness a hike of up to Rs 32,000. The compact SUV is available at a starting price of Rs 5.62 lakh (ex-showroom).

Besides the upcoming price hike, Nissan will also launch a new MPV in February 2026. It will be called Gravit,e and it is essentially a rebadged version of the new Renault Triber MPV. The Gravite MPV will position Nissan in the B-MPV segment, thus creating a rival to the entry-level Maruti Ertiga variants.
